Marina Koshevaya (born April 1, 1960 in Moscow) is a former Soviet swimmer and olympic champion. She competed at the 1976 Olympic Games in Montreal, where she received a gold medal in 200 m breaststroke, and a bronze medal in 100 m breaststroke.[1]
